Our Summer Reading Volunteers register children for One World, Many Stories, distribute prizes to those young summer readers, and assist Library Instructors with various tasks throughout the summer. Summer Reading Volunteers spend their summer in air conditioning, surrounded by books and readers. What could be better?
Summer Reading Volunteers need to be at least 13 years old and enjoy working with children. Interested students should complete a volunteer application. Accepted applicants will be contacted to schedule orientation and training.
